THE KNOWLEDGE<br />

Pretty much all the shirts and tees in this section will claim to be good at<br />

wicking, but what exactly is wicking? Also known as capillary action,<br />

wicking is the process of moving moisture between spaces; for example<br />

from the surface of your skin, through layers of clothing, to an outer surface<br />

– even though in theory, gravity is working against it. Once on the outer<br />

surface, the moisture can spread out, which means it will evaporate more<br />

quickly and cease troubling you. (The most versatile shirts and baselayers<br />

will do this in winter too, preventing moisture from chilling your skin.)<br />

THE KNOWLEDGE<br />

The more you walk in summer, the better your body gets at dealing with heat.<br />

Studies have shown we generate 13% more plasma (the liquid part of our<br />

blood) when we exercise consistently in warm conditions than we do<br />

normally, loading our muscles with oxygen (and thus energy) and improving<br />

our ability to regulate our own body temperature. And after a few consecutive<br />

days in the heat (say, on a long-distance trail) our heart, lungs and sweat<br />

glands all adapt and reach maximum effciency, meaning that steep ascents<br />

become less taxing than they seemed on day one of your trip.<br />

THE KNOWLEDGE<br />

Jack Wolfskin and Osprey have both launched rucksacks created with<br />

3D printing, but what’s the big deal with this new approach? Well, 3D printing<br />

uses materials which can be far lighter and more breathable than standard<br />

fabrics – especially when it comes to padding. So the padding on Wolfskin’s<br />

Aerorise and Osprey’s UNLTD packs is a soft lattice structure allowing vastly<br />

improved elasticity and dynamic movement. It also reduces water usage<br />

and waste material. As the technology is young, prices are eye-watering, but<br />

hopefully we’ll see them come down as the practice becomes more common.<br />

THE KNOWLEDGE<br />

Ever used a water filter? It’s one of those niche areas of the outdoor<br />

industry. They have obvious merit for adventurous trekkers who are likely to<br />

spend days in the wilderness without access to a tap. But as days like that<br />

aren’t so common in the UK, you might be perfectly happy to fill up your<br />

bottle in the morning and just ration it carefully during the day. But having a<br />

filter and reservoir is a brilliant fallback: when empty they take up next to no<br />

space, but they mean that if you run out, you can quickly take water from a<br />

stream or lake and turn it into safe drinking water in a couple of minutes.<br />

THE KNOWLEDGE<br />

The names of Bridgedale socks tend to be quite a mouthful, but in fact when<br />

you break them down they make perfect sense, and are simply helping you<br />

find exactly what you need in their vast range. They divide into Range (Hike,<br />

Explorer, Waterproof, Liner), Weight (Ultra Light, Lightweight, Midweight,<br />

Heavyweight), Fabric (Coolmax or Merino) and Activity (Performance,<br />

Endurance, Sport). So if you know what you’re looking for, the product<br />

name will take you straight to the sock you need. On this page, it’s the Hike<br />

Ultra Light Coolmax Performance – and trust us, it won’t let you down.<br />

THE KNOWLEDGE<br />

A waterproof’s job isn’t just about dealing with rain; it’s equally about dealing<br />

with humidity – especially in summer. Humidity is the amount of water vapour<br />

in the atmosphere around you, and in waterproof jackets, it’s the job of the<br />

mid and inner fabric layers to manage andmoderate humidity. If those barrier<br />

layers fail, moisture (ie. sweat) will not be conveyed to the outer layer and<br />

humidity will increase. The result? Condensation and moisture can’t get out,<br />

and instead seeps back through your base layer and onto your skin. This is why<br />

it’s important to reproof your jacket and keep its membrane in top condition.<br />
